Bryce Point Capital LLC raised its position in shares of Hayward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:HAYW - Free Report) by 99.3%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 62,508 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 31,149 shares during the quarter. Bryce Point Capital LLC's holdings in Hayward were worth $907,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Hayward (NYSE:HAYW -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 30th. The company reported $0.24 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.22 by $0.02. Hayward had a return on equity of 10.94% and a net margin of 11.53%. The company had revenue of $299.60 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$291.17 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$0.21 EPS. Hayward's quarterly revenue was up 5.3%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ts predict that Hayward Holdings, Inc. will post 0.6 EPS for the current year.

Hayward Holdings, Inc designs, manufactures, and markets a portfolio of pool equipment and associated automation systems in North America, Europe, and internationally. The company offers pool equipment, including pumps, filters, robotics, suction and pressure cleaners, gas heaters and heat pumps, water features and landscape lighting, water sanitizers, salt chlorine generators, safety equipment, and in-floor automated cleaning systems, as well as LED illumination solutions.
